Some people think I should be 'over it' by now. After all, my caring for him has been a long journey. I should have been prepared. We spent 6 months together in the dying process. Each precious moment sometimes felt like forever.
I sometimes wish we had longer and know we didn't.
The death of a close loved one changes you.
For 30 years we were partners. Our lives were so intertwined that we were part of each other.
But your gone. So half of me is gone too.
But who am I now? I feel as if I am missing half of me. It is hard to figure out who I am. I have to recreate myself in some ways.
The joy of sharing my escapades and adventures is gone so what is the point of them?
When I had a bad day, you'd comfort me, even if you weren't feeling well.
I'm trying to be normal around others and I think I pull it off pretty well. Most of the time.
I'll sit at the gym before our class and listen to some of the ladies talk about pretty bullshitty stuff. Stuff that seems to not matter anymore, not to me at least. I wonder what would happen if I told them what I thought.
They'd just think I'm a nasty woman. Really? Makeup and gym tights are things worth fretting over?
~~~~
Death and grief changes you.
It changes your perspective on everything. I do mean everything.
And then comes a bad day. I mean bad enough that nothing goes right.
For the very first time in my life, I could not do anything. I didn't care. I just sat in the quiet of the house and knew I had entered a place of emotional numbness. I felt nothing. Not even pain.
Charlie crept into my lap and made no demands.
For a whole day, I was lost.
I gave myself that day. I had earned it.
